Course Overview
CISA is the globally recognized gold standard for IS audit, control, and assurance, in demand and valued by leading global brands. It’s often a mandatory qualification for employment as an IT auditor. CISA holders have validated ability to apply a risk-based approach to planning, executing and reporting on audit engagements. There are 150 Questions on the exam which must be completed in 4 hours. It is available online via remote proctoring and at in-person testing centres where available.

The Exam
This course is recommended as preparation for the CISA Exam, which can be purchased separately. Of the exam:
- Duration: 4 hours
- Number of questions: 150 multiple choice
- Languages: English, Chinese Traditional, Chinese Simplified, French, German, Hebrew, Italian, Japanese, Korean, Spanish and Turkish
